1977 BMW 728 vs. 2006 Suzuki Jimny

To start off, 2006 Suzuki Jimny is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1977 BMW 728.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1977 BMW 728 would be higher. At 2,788 cc (6 cylinders), 1977 BMW 728 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1977 BMW 728 (170 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 91 more horse power than 2006 Suzuki Jimny. (79 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1977 BMW 728 should accelerate faster than 2006 Suzuki Jimny.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1977 BMW 728 weights approximately 501 kg more than 2006 Suzuki Jimny.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2006 Suzuki Jimny is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1977 BMW 728.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Suzuki Jimny will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1977 BMW 728 (235 Nm @ 3700 RPM) has 131 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Suzuki Jimny. (104 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 1977 BMW 728 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Suzuki Jimny.

Compare all specifications:

1977 BMW 728 2006 Suzuki Jimny
Make BMW Suzuki
Model 728 Jimny
Year Released 1977 2006
Body Type Sedan S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2788 cc 1298 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 170 HP 79 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 235 Nm 104 Nm
Torque RPM 3700 RPM 4500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 86 mm 74 mm
Engine Stroke Size 80 mm 75.5 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.0:1 9.5:1
Top Speed 193 km/hour 140 km/hour
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1536 kg 1035 kg
Vehicle Length 4870 mm 3630 mm
Vehicle Width 1810 mm 1610 mm
Vehicle Height 1440 mm 1670 mm
Wheelbase Size 2800 mm 2260 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 85 L 40 L
